Transaction 8647567405fa104f1141c42030f5bf9557acc282cb120aac56c4df513f2e5fb7
1 Input
1 Output
-
8647567405fa104f1141c42030f5bf9557acc282cb120aac56c4df513f2e5fb7:0
- value
- 17000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62edc46f9cc812035b36814289c9a897bcbb5e48 OP_EQUAL
- address
- 3Ai6yhwdPuNWMedFLPcXBWW1Apg24HjbdA